Distance from Wi-ju to Shanghai

The distance between Wi-ju, North Korea and Shanghai, China is 1,020 kilometers (634 miles)

Country: North Korea

Region: P'yŏngan-bukto

City: Wi-ju

Country: China

Region: Shanghai

City: Shanghai

Travel time

Mode Estimated time
Bicycle 3-4 days
Motorcycle 1-2 days
Car 1-2 days
Airplane 1-2 hours
Speed Time
50 km/h
100 km/h
150 km/h

Wi-ju, North Korea

Local time:

Coordinates: 40.1006° N 124.3981° E


Nearby airports:
  • Uiju Airport (UJU)
  • Dandong Airport (DDG)
  • Pyongyang Sunan International Airport (FNJ)
  • Anshan Air Base (AOG)
  • Changhai Airport (CNI)

Shanghai, China

Local time:

Coordinates: 31.2222° N 121.4581° E


Nearby airports:
  • Shanghai Hongqiao International Airport (SHA)
  • Shanghai Pudong International Airport (PVG)
  • Suzhou Guangfu Airport (SZV)
  • Wuxi Airport (WUX)
  • Rugao Air Base (RUG)

Other distances from Wi-ju

Distance between cities Kilometers
From Wi-ju to Pyongyang 166 km
From Wi-ju to Chongjin 490 km
From Wi-ju to Hienhing 269 km
From Wi-ju to Namp’o 175 km
From Wi-ju to Haeju 255 km

Other distances from Shanghai

Distances between cities Kilometers
From Shanghai to Beijing 1,067 km
From Shanghai to Tianjin 961 km
From Shanghai to Shenzhen 1,209 km
From Shanghai to Wuhan 691 km
From Shanghai to Dongguan 1,187 km

Cities within similar distances

The following list contains cities that are at equal or similar distances as between Wi-ju and Shanghai.

From To Distance (kilometers)
San Antonio, United States Cuilacan, Mexico 1,020 km
New South Memphis, United States Cleveland, United States 1,020 km
Dongguan, China Chongqing, China 1,020 km
Goiânia, Brazil Serra, Brazil 1,019 km
Chihuahua, Mexico Plano, United States 1,021 km
Naucalpan de Juárez, Mexico Mérida, Mexico 1,019 km
Nashville, United States Arlington, United States 1,021 km
San Luis, Mexico Tuxtla, Mexico 1,019 km
Phoenix, United States Sacramento, United States 1,022 km
Austin, United States Kansas City, United States 1,022 km
Tulsa, United States Nuevo Laredo, Mexico 1,018 km
Chennai, India Navi Mumbai, India 1,018 km
Valencia, Venezuela Ibagué, Colombia 1,018 km
Mérida, Mexico Álvaro Obregón, Mexico 1,018 km
Mixco, Guatemala Ixtapaluca, Mexico 1,022 km
Maracaibo, Venezuela Ciudad Guayana, Venezuela 1,018 km
Santa Cruz de la Sierra, Bolivia San Miguel de Tucumán, Argentina 1,023 km
León de los Aldama, Mexico Tuxtla, Mexico 1,023 km
San Antonio, United States Memphis, United States 1,017 km
Rosario, Argentina Salta, Argentina 1,017 km

Measure more distances between cities